CEA Tech is the technology research unit of the French Atomic Energy and Alternative Energy Commission (CEA), a key player in research, development and innovation in defense & security, nuclear energy, technological research for industry and fundamental physical and life sciences.
In 2015, Thomson Reuters identified CEA as the most innovative research organization in the world.
CEA Tech's three labs—Leti, Liten, and List—develop a broad portfolio of technologies for ICTs, energy, and healthcare.
CEA Tech leverages a unique innovation-driven culture and unrivalled expertise to develop and disseminate new technologies for industry, effectively bridging the gap between the worlds of research and business.
CEA Tech is building on CEA Leti's successful track record innovating for industry. Our organization's 4,500 researchers and administrative staff are dedicated to bringing manufacturers a broad range of Key Enabling Technologies developed by Leti, List, Liten, and other CEA operating divisions.

Weebit Nano

Weebit Nano, founded in 2015, is a publicly traded company specializing in resistive RAM (ReRAM) technology. The company focuses on IP licensing, allowing foundries and semiconductor companies to integrate ReRAM into their products. Weebit has secured key partnerships, including CEA-Leti, DB HiTek, GlobalFoundries, and Onsemi, with Onsemi marking the first major ReRAM licensing deal in the industry. Its first embedded ReRAM product is manufactured on SkyWater's 130nm CMOS process, targeting automotive, IoT, and industrial applications. While its initial commercial offerings are at 130nm, Weebit has successfully demonstrated its ReRAM at 22nm.

CEA

CEA is an interdisciplinary research institute in France active in low carbon energies, information and healthcare technologies, defence, and security. IDTechEx spoke with Dr Claire Agraffeil, Project Manager in CEA's department of solar technology, on sustainable and circular photovoltaics. The interview focussed on developments in the €10M PHOTORAMA project, a circular photovoltaics project of which CEA is a member.
